20110263909 | Method For Reprocessing Aircraft De-Icing Agents Comprising Glycol - The invention relates to a method for reprocessing aircraft de-icing agents comprising glycol, wherein (1) the used aircraft de-icing agents are collected in a suitable device, (2) the used aircraft de-icing agent is subsequently brought to a propylene glycol content of between 55 and 75% by weight without prior separating of solid or suspended impurities by expelling water at increased temperature, (3) the concentrated used aircraft de-icing agent thus obtained is transported to a central reprocessing system, where the same is subjected to a fine distillation, and wherein (4) propylene glycol is produced as a distillate of the fine distillation. | 10-27-2011 |

20090277431 | Internal combustion engine with an exhaust-gas recirculation and method for operating an internal combustion engine - An internal combustion engine has a high-pressure exhaust-gas recirculation line and a low-pressure exhaust-gas recirculation line with a low-pressure exhaust-gas recirculation valve. The low-pressure exhaust-gas recirculation line branches off from the exhaust-gas system downstream of a turbine of an exhaust-gas turbocharger and opens into a fresh-air system upstream of a compressor of the exhaust-gas turbocharger. An exhaust-gas flap is disposed in the exhaust-gas system downstream from where the low-pressure exhaust-gas recirculation line branches off from the exhaust-gas system. At least one pressure sensor is disposed in the low-pressure exhaust-gas recirculation line and configured such that the at least one pressure sensor determines a pressure difference in the low-pressure exhaust-gas recirculation line between a point upstream of the low-pressure exhaust-gas recirculation valve and a point downstream of the low-pressure exhaust-gas recirculation valve. A method for operating an internal combustion engine is also provided. | 11-12-2009 |

20160121865 | Hydraulic Device of a Vehicle Braking System - A hydraulic device of a vehicle braking system includes a storage reservoir configured to store brake fluid. The hydraulic device further includes a pump with a suction side configured to set a brake fluid pressure in at least one associated wheel brake. The hydraulic device also includes a line connection interposed between the storage reservoir and the suction side of the pump. In addition, the hydraulic device includes a high-pressure switching valve arranged in the line connection. The high-pressure switching valve is configured to possess an opening pressure of less than 1 bar. Further, the hydraulic device includes at least one brake circuit, and the at least one brake circuit includes the pump, the line connection, and the high-pressure switching valve. | 05-05-2016 |

20140062809 | ANTENNA ARRAY IN A MOTOR VEHICLE - An antenna array for a motor vehicle has at least one seal which is composed of a non-conductive material and has an antenna which is mounted in the region of a sealing face of the seal and has the purpose of receiving radio signals. A convertible roof or sun roof or some other metallic vehicle part which is part of the antenna array can be positioned against the sealing face during the operation of the antenna and removed again. The antenna forms, with the metallic vehicle part which bears against the seal, the slot antenna which is effective between at least two metal faces. On the other hand, in the state in which no vehicle part bears against the seal, the antenna forms a flat electrical reception monopole which extends at a distance from a metal face which forms the antenna ground. | 03-06-2014 |
